DNS Monitoring: A Comprehensive GuideDNS Monitoring: A Comprehensive Guide
The Domain Name System (DNS) is a critical component of the internet infrastructure that translates domain names into IP addresses. Without DNS, users wouldn’t be able to access websites, send emails, or use any internet-based service. However, DNS is also a prime target for cybercriminals who can use it to launch DDoS attacks, phishing scams, and other malicious activities. That’s why DNS monitoring is essential to detect and mitigate these threats.
What is DNS Monitoring?
DNS monitoring refers to the process of continuously monitoring and analyzing DNS traffic to detect anomalies and potential security breaches. It involves collecting DNS data, analyzing it, and generating alerts or reports to identify potential threats.
Why DNS Monitoring Matters?
DNS is a critical component of internet connectivity, and any disruption to DNS services can have severe consequences for businesses and individuals. Here are some of the reasons why it matters:
- Identify and mitigate DNS attacks: DNS attacks, such as DNS hijacking or DNS cache poisoning, can compromise the security and integrity of your network. DNS monitoring can help you detect and mitigate these attacks before they cause any damage.
- Ensure website availability: If your website is not resolving correctly, it can lead to DNS downtime and lost revenue. Domain Name System monitoring can help you identify and resolve issues before they impact your website visitors.
- Optimize website performance: DNS resolution times can significantly impact website performance. Monitoring your DNS can help you identify and address any issues that might be slowing down your website.
How to Monitor DNS?
Now that we know why monitoring your Domain Name System matters, let’s take a look at how to do it right. Here are some tips for effective DNS monitoring:
- Use a reliable tool: Several tools are available in the market, but not all are created equal. Look for a tool that can monitor DNS queries and responses in real-time, provide detailed analytics, and alert you in case of any anomalies.
- Monitor from multiple locations: DNS resolution times can vary depending on the location of the user. Monitor from multiple locations to get an accurate picture of your DNS performance.
- Set up alerts: Setting up alerts for DNS anomalies can help you take proactive measures before they cause any damage. Set up alerts for excessive response times, unexpected domain names, or any other anomalies that might be relevant to your network.
- Regularly review DNS logs: DNS logs can help you identify patterns and trends that might indicate potential issues. Make sure to review your DNS logs regularly to stay ahead of any potential problems.
Conclusion
DNS monitoring is a critical aspect of network security and performance. By monitoring Domain Name System queries and responses, you can identify and mitigate DNS attacks, ensure website availability, and optimize website performance. To do it right, use a reliable tool, monitor from multiple locations, set up alerts, and regularly review DNS logs. With these best practices in place, you can ensure the security and performance of your network.